Director, Sustaining Engineering & Lab Operations

What You'll Be Building

  • Local Site Sustaining Engineering (incl. Maintenance Engineering)
    • Build the Local Site Sustaining Engineering function from scratch in partnership with HCE and Global Engineering; incorporates Maintenance Engineering (instrument PM, calibration, first-response troubleshooting) as a sub-capability
    • Own fleet reliability, incident response, and AISF health at the site — on-call rotations, severity policy, incident playbooks, RCA library
    • Own deployment, commissioning, and operational readiness; partner with the Deployment Project team during stand-up and own steady-state post-handoff
    • Execute the two-lane change model: route platform-critical changes (Lane A) through Global Change Control; manage bounded site-local changes (Lane B) within explicit guardrails; document and time-box emergency-path bypasses
    • Provide the site signature for the dual-signoff go-live model (Platform Release Certification + Site/Workcell Commissioning acceptance)
    • Drive site-level continuous improvement within platform guardrails; surface candidates for promotion into platform releases
    • Triage equipment health data and act on drift signals and re-qualification triggers defined by the Equivalence Review
    • Define escalation and handoff protocols between Sustaining, ME, LabOps, Research Ops, and HCE/Automation
    • Represent the site in standing cadences: Platform Change Control, Release Readiness Review, Fleet Health Review, Equivalence Review

    What You’ll Need to Succeed

    • 12–15+ years of engineering and operations experience with a primary background in sustaining engineering, reliability engineering, or site-level engineering execution for complex hardware-software integrated systems (automation, robotics, semiconductor, aerospace, medical devices, advanced manufacturing, or similar)
    • Demonstrated track record of owning fleet reliability, incident response, and root cause analysis at scale — severity policies, RCA cadences, MTBF/MTTR programs, durable corrective actions
    • Experience operating within (or building) a structured change control model — versioned releases, change boards, traceability of "what's running where" across sites
    • Track record of defining and scaling sustaining or site-level engineering systems — built operating models and governance, not just inherited them
    • Strong operations instincts — engineering rigor only matters if day-to-day execution (supply continuity, asset management, PM, shift coverage) actually works, and you're willing to own that scope directly
    • Experience building and leading teams across multiple functions, shifts, or sites, including hiring from scratch
    • Comfortable in a solid-line / dotted-line accountability structure and partnering with a central engineering authority on standards
    • Recognized authority in your domain; comfortable operating as a peer to VPs and senior leaders
    • Strong strategic and systems-level thinking
